Transaction

5964f420dc277df90ff034d98363ca58480821a9949cb38c2ba54c19f508f7d3

Summary

In Block44855
TimeSun, 05 Feb 2023 05:44:45 UTC
Total Input895.265625 Nebula
Total Output950.265625 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
922396 Confirmations950.265625 Nebula
Raw Transaction